Handover: BranchReaper bot. It sweeps stale branches in the Quillwork repos every Sunday night; anything untouched 90+ days gets flagged, 120+ gets deleted (with a tombstone tag, don't panic). Config lives in the reaper.yml at repo root. I'm rolling off to the Lanternfish project, so ping the new owner with questions.

named custodian: Oliath Ralax

Subject: Ownership change — Cartsmith checkout load testing

Team, effective Monday, responsibility for load testing the Cartsmith checkout flow moves off the platform rotation. Scheduled runs continue Tuesdays and Thursdays; results post to the usual dashboard. If customers report checkout slowness during a test window, note the timestamp in the ticket and escalate to the new owner named below.

approver of kawig-fahof = Wenvan Prair

## Onboarding: Sproutly Watering Scheduler

For the weekly eng sync: Sproutly computes watering windows per plant from soil-moisture readings and a per-species curve, then enqueues jobs on the Trellis worker pool. Schedules regenerate nightly; manual overrides expire after 48 hours. The scheduler config is fetched at boot from the Greenhouse config service and will refuse to start if the payload fails verification — this has caught two bad pushes already. Config payloads are validated against the key below.

signing key of bagap-yawep = bky13_TbfT6ZMUoGJo2

Ticket #4182 — Flaky DNS lookups on resolver-east. Heads up: the cached creds for the Quillhook lookup service expired last Tuesday, which is why retries against nameline.internal keep failing intermittently. It's not actually DNS this time, promise. We rotated the creds this morning and verified resolution works. For your audit, the new key is below.

service key, fawip-bajef: kto11_Qt5wZK9vdNC